1-866-909-4086
Jeff was great. Answered all my questions
Foundation repair
Installation crew was able to make changes to save us money
Always courteous and very good at clean up each and every time we have had work done by you...
A good experience from the 1st phone call to the installation. Everyone was knowledgeable,...